Potential Rampart Buffs (Suggestions)
Just a list of potential rampart buffs that have crossed my mind or been discussed around. This is not a suggestion that he receives ALL these buffs but that some of them COULD be good for his build and wanted to list them where dev team could potentially
- rampart's passive affects all machine gun type weaponry to some extent, with LMG's receiving the most benefit
- ramparts wall is built in two parts. when activated the first part of her wall begins setting up, and once finished is a solid destructible object (not one shot until its fully finished). Then the second part attempts to finish setting up for the full effect. Basically the wall can only be one shot during its setup part, and the shield can be one shot during its setup part. This would mean rampart can still place cover, even if not amped cover, in combat situations. That is unless the enemy shoots the first part of the wall while its setting up to prevent that. Having a tactical completely rendered inert unless you "catch the enemy off guard" or "get there ahead of time" regardless of original design intent, massively hurts the character.
- 360 turret swivel emplacement. if that's too strong, when aiming down sights lock direction until zoom out with similar swivel lock to how it currently functions.
- this is more of a QoL / fun, but the paintball mod is in the game files, why isn't she using it? It's literally got her logo on it and suites her character. It's not like the spitfire has any other alt fire mod at present anyway and its literally already attached to weapons via her passive anyway.
- additional passive effect that adds benefits to other players gear abilities, "modding" it so to speak. Octane's jump pad or wattson's fences for example.
- this ones a bit crazy, but perhaps the ability to mod doors into makeshift walls? sawing off the top and attaching amped cover? would become destructible like her walls.
- ability to place the amped shield onto surfaces apart from the wall, like desks or hand railings.
- ability to raise height of turret above ground to some extent. while risky as it puts you in the open, it can also give a height advantage to see or shoot enemies.
- The modifying idea's could even tie into requiring crafting materials to perform the actions.
